What Does It Mean to Live in the Forest?
Living in the forest is a lifestyle choice that involves stepping away from the conveniences of modern urban living to embrace a simpler, more sustainable way of life. For Misty, this decision reflects a desire to live closer to nature, minimize her carbon footprint, and adopt a minimalist lifestyle. Below are some key elements of forest living:
- Constructing or repurposing eco-friendly homes, such as cabins or tiny houses.
- Practicing permaculture and sustainable farming to grow food.
- Utilizing renewable energy sources like solar panels or wind turbines.
- Implementing water conservation and waste management strategies.

Overcoming the Challenges of Forest Living
Financial Considerations
While the allure of forest living is undeniable, it comes with financial challenges. Building a sustainable home in the forest can be expensive, especially when considering land acquisition, construction materials, and renewable energy systems. According to the U.S. Department of Agriculture, the cost of constructing an eco-friendly home ranges from $150,000 to $300,000, depending on the location and size.
However, many forest dwellers offset these costs by adopting a minimalist lifestyle. By reducing reliance on material possessions and focusing on experiences, they achieve financial independence while living in harmony with nature. This approach highlights the importance of balancing cost considerations with the benefits of a sustainable lifestyle.

Physical and Mental Demands
Living in the forest requires physical fitness and resilience. Tasks such as chopping wood, maintaining gardens, and sourcing water can be labor-intensive. Moreover, the isolation from urban centers may lead to feelings of loneliness or cabin fever.
Despite these challenges, many forest dwellers report improved mental health due to increased exposure to nature. A study by the University of Exeter found that individuals who spend at least two hours per week in natural environments experience better physical and psychological well-being compared to those who do not. This underscores the positive impact of forest living on mental health.

Practical Steps for Aspiring Forest Dwellers
Choosing the Right Location
Selecting an appropriate location is a critical first step for anyone considering forest living. Factors such as climate, accessibility to essential services, and proximity to community support networks should be carefully evaluated. Consulting with local authorities and environmental organizations can provide valuable insights into zoning laws and conservation regulations.
For example, regions with temperate climates and abundant water sources may be more suitable for beginners. Additionally, areas with established forest communities can offer mentorship and resources for new residents. This highlights the importance of thorough research and planning when choosing a location.
Building a Sustainable Home
Constructing an eco-friendly home is a vital component of forest living. Options include building a cabin from sustainable materials, repurposing existing structures, or investing in prefabricated tiny houses. Incorporating renewable energy systems and water conservation technologies can further enhance sustainability.
It's essential to work with professionals experienced in green building practices to ensure compliance with safety standards and environmental regulations. This investment can lead to reduced utility bills and increased property value, making it a worthwhile endeavor for aspiring forest dwellers.

Expert Insights on Forest Living
Keys to Success
To ensure a successful transition to forest living, experts recommend the following:
- Start small by spending weekends or vacations in nature to gauge your comfort level.
- Research local regulations and consult with experienced forest dwellers before making any major decisions.
- Invest in skills such as gardening, carpentry, and first aid to enhance self-sufficiency.
- Build a support network of like-minded individuals for emotional and practical assistance.
By taking these steps, aspiring forest dwellers can increase their chances of success and enjoyment in their new lifestyle. This underscores the importance of preparation and community in achieving a fulfilling forest living experience.
